The ethical implications of Imam Zain al-Abidin’s teachings also extend to environmental stewardship. His emphasis on respect and care for all of God’s creations resonates profoundly in today’s context of environmental degradation. The notion that humans bear a responsibility toward the earth reflects an understanding of the interconnectedness of all life. By nurturing a sense of ecological consciousness, followers can embody the Imam’s teachings, thereby contributing to a more sustainable and harmonious existence.
